EU commissioner Apostolos Tzitzikostas has announced €17bn to modernize Europe's transport infrastructure, essential in the event of conflict.

In an interview with the Financial Times, Apostolos Tzitzikostas stressed the need to modernize Europe's roads, bridges and railways to allow the rapid movement of military equipment in the event of conflict with Russia. The €17 billion will be used to build and widen infrastructure, with four military corridors involving around 500 projects planned. The allocation will be made over the period 2028-2034, separate from the defense budget of 5% of member countries' GDP.
